Observed only in the Zapata Swamp and Isle of Youth of Cuba It really is a small but really intense species of crocodile that prefers freshwater swamps.[fifty] The coloration is vibrant even as adults and also the scales have a "pebbled" visual appeal. It is actually a comparatively terrestrial species with agile locomotion on land, and often displays terrestrial looking. The snout is wide by using a thick upper-jaw and huge enamel.

The mugger crocodile, also known as mugger and marsh crocodile is often a medium-sized broad-snouted crocodile which is native to freshwater habitats of southern Iran into the Indian subcontinent.

Gharials are classified as the smallest spouse and children of crocodilians, they usually typically live in the rivers and freshwater habitats of South Asia. They’re Significantly more compact than other sorts of crocodilian and like hotter climates, hence their much more compact distribution.

five. A simple way to inform the distinction between a crocodile and an alligator, is whenever a crocodile closes it’s mouth, all enamel are obvious – given that the upper and reduced jaw are exactly the same width.

When wanting to catch the attention of a mate, male crocodiles genuinely learn how to woo a Woman. They’ll have interaction in courtship shows that include A selection of vocalizations including a deep bellowing audio which will travel above a lengthy distance.

In line with a 2015 analyze, crocodiles interact in a few main forms of Participate in conduct (which Fagen, 1981 labeled): locomotor Participate in, Perform with objects and social Enjoy. Participate in with objects is noted most frequently, but locomotor Participate in like regularly sliding down slopes, and social Participate in like riding within the backs of other crocodiles is likewise claimed. This behaviour was exhibited with conspecifics read more and mammals and is outwardly not unusual. [124]
